The Mechanics of 4 Diy Secrets To Create Your Dream Conditioner At Home: A Step-by-Step Guide
So, how do you get started on your DIY conditioner journey? The process is surprisingly simple, and requires just a few basic ingredients and some patience. Here’s a step-by-step guide to creating your first DIY conditioner:
- Choose your ingredients: From coconut oil and shea butter to argan oil and olive oil, the possibilities are endless. Research the properties of each ingredient to determine which ones will work best for your hair type.
- Mix and match: Combine your chosen ingredients in a ratio that works for you. Start with small batches and adjust as needed.
- Add preservatives (optional): If you plan to store your conditioner for an extended period, you may need to add preservatives to prevent spoilage.
- Test and refine: Use your DIY conditioner as you would a store-bought product, and make adjustments as needed.

Q: Is it safe to use these ingredients on my hair?
A: Most of the ingredients used in DIY conditioners are safe and gentle, but it’s always important to do a patch test before applying to your entire head.
Q: How long does it take to see results?
A: The effectiveness of your DIY conditioner will depend on the ingredients and your individual hair type. It may take some trial and error to find the right combination, but with patience and persistence, you can achieve amazing results.
